The existence of ‘I’ requires the existence of awareness, which is the nervous

energy. In deep sleep there is no existence of nervous energy and therefore

there is no question of the existence of ‘I’ in that state. The ‘I’ requires the

awareness of itself. This awareness or nervous energy is a special form of inert

energy only. The inert energy produced by the chemicals in the brain flowing

through nervous system becomes the awareness or nervous energy. The rain water

fallen in the river Ganga is called as the sacred Ganga. The same rain water

fallen in a tank is called as tank water. In deep sleep the energy existing in

other systems is called as the heat of the body. Thus, there is no difference

between the heat energy and nervous energy in the fundamental essence.

 

When the nervous energy is absent, the feelings are also absent which are

called vasanas or samskaras. But the same feelings exist in the form of Gunas,

which are the pulses stored by the inert energy existing in the brain. The

qualities exist like a computer chip in the computer. Then the computer is not

in the state of working because in that state the electricity is not flowing in

the computer. This electricity can be treated as the nervous energy, which is

absent in the deep sleep. The chip in the computer is in the form of material

and this material is the brain. The pulses are in the form of inert energy. This

inert energy can be even called as matter from the angle of a scientist. The

scientist does not distinguish matter and energy at this level of inert energy.

Thus, the Jeeva, who is a bundle of qualities, exists as a bundle of pulses

called as “Sphotas” by the Hindu scriptures (Sastras). These pulses are stored

by the inert energy called as chittam. You are not

aware of any information stored by chittam. These pulses are the waves of the

inert energy. Thus, the very material of pulse is the inert energy. Therefore,

the material of these pulses is chittam.

 

You can call chittam as matter in the microstate as per the terminology of a

scientist. When the same chittam or inert energy flows in the nervous system,

the same chittam is called as nervous energy or awareness. Thus, basically there

is no difference between the awareness and inert energy. The same inert energy

when flows in a superior part of the brain in doing decisions is called as

intelligence (Buddhi). The same inert energy flowing in nervous system becomes

aware of itself is called as egoism (Ahankara). The same inert energy flowing in

the nervous system, aware of other objects or other information is called as

mind (Manas).

 

The mind, intelligence and egoism can be treated as awareness or nervous

energy because in these three faculties the awareness of other objects (as in

the case of mind and intelligence) or the awareness of itself (as in the case of

egoism) exist. But, in the case of faculty of chittam in the state of inert

energy, the awareness does not exist. Therefore, you are not aware of the

information stored by chittam.
